Jefferson County, Kentucky has a median effective property tax rate of 1.17% — above the Kentucky state average of 0.80%. For a home valued at $300,000, the estimated annual tax bill is $3,504 ($292/month). Rates vary by city within the county; browse the list below or use the calculator to estimate your bill.

Property tax rates in Jefferson County, Kentucky
1.116%
25% of properties pay this rate or less
1.168%
50% of properties pay this rate or less
1.178%
25% of properties pay more than this rate
These percentiles show the range of property tax rates. 25% of properties pay less than the low rate, 50% pay less than the median, and 75% pay less than the high rate.
The difference between the 25th and 75th percentiles is 0.062%, indicating the variation in property tax rates within this area. Use the median (50th percentile) for the most typical estimate.
State averages sourced from Tax Foundation 2024 data. National median: 1.07%.
Based on the median rate of 1.168%. Actual taxes depend on assessed value and local exemptions.
| Home Value | Annual Tax | Monthly Equivalent |
|---|---|---|
| $150,000 | $1,752 | $146/mo |
| $250,000 | $2,920 | $243/mo |
| $350,000 | $4,088 | $341/mo |
| $500,000 | $5,840 | $487/mo |
| $750,000 | $8,760 | $730/mo |
| $1,000,000 | $11,680 | $973/mo |
